Determination of the Circular Polarized Fraction of Light using a Voltage Driven Nematic Liquid Crystal Wave-Plate

2005 
ABSTRACT We present a two measurement method to extract the circularly polarized fraction of light at a particular wavelength. It involves a voltage driven nematic liquid crystal wave-plate and a polarizing filter oriented with their axes 45° to each other. The circular polarized component is calculated from intensities transmitted when the liquid crystal wave-plate acts as a 1/4 wave-plate at one voltage and 3/4-wave plate at another.
